/* exec.c */
unistdh #include<.>
main void(void)
{
envp char*[]={"PATH=/tmp","USER=lingdxuyan","STATUS=testing",NULL};
argv_execv char*[]={"echo","excuted by execv",NULL};
argv_execvp char*[]={"echo","executed by execvp",NULL};
argv_execve char*[]={"env",NULL};
fork 0 if(()==)
execl 0 if(("/bin/echo","echo","executed by execl",NULL)<)
perror("Err on execl");
fork 0 if(()==)
execlp 0 if(("echo","echo","executed by execlp",NULL)<)
perror("Err on execlp");
fork 0 if(()==)
execle envp 0 if(("/usr/bin/env","env",NULL,)<)
perror("Err on execle");
fork 0 if(()==)
execv argv_execv 0 if(("/bin/echo",)<)
perror("Err on execv");
fork 0 if(()==)
execvp argv_execvp 0 if(("echo",)<)
perror("Err on execvp");
fork 0 if(()==)
execve argv_execve envp 0 if(("/usr/bin/env",,)<)
perror("Err on execve");
}
Linux进程控制——exec函数族
原创下一篇:值-结果参数
-
Linux进程控制--exec家族
用fork创建子进程后执行的是和父进程相同的程序(但有可能执行不同的代码分支),子进程往往要调用一种exec函数以执行另一
#include 环境变量 linux -
初学-Linux多进程--exec族函数
在我们需要使用多进程编程时,有两种比较常见的情况一个父进程希望复制自己,使父、子进程同时执行不同的代码段。在
linux 算法 c语言 #include 可执行文件 -
linux exec函数族
exec函数族关键字:exec函数族首先,我们来看一下什么是exec函数族? 所谓exec函数族,就是以exec开头的函数,比如execl函数、execlp函数等,所以称它为exec函数族。...
linux exec函数族 #include c函数 子进程 -
linux exec函数族演示
就是调用系统的程序,自定义的脚本不知为何有时不行。。自定义二进制文件却可以。1.execl list 列出
linux exec函数族 #include 数组 父进程 -
Linux下进程控制函数
Linux下进程控制函数
Linux #include 共享内存 子进程 -
exec族函数
exec族函数 execl(执行文件)
职场 休闲 exec族函数 execle -
关于守护进程和exec函数族
守护进程的基本操作,以及当守护进程与exec函数族一起使用时产生的问题
linux c++ 守护进程 c函数 父进程 -
linux下的 进程控制 以及常见的进程控制函数
基于linux的 进程控制 以及常见的进程控制函数
进程 进程控制 控制函数 -
mybatis 查询Java拼接好的sql
1. Mybatis介绍MyBatis 本是apache的一个开源项目iBatis, 2010年这个项目由apache software foundation 迁移到了google code,并且改名为MyBatis 。2013年11月迁移到Github。MyBatis是一个优秀的持久层框架,它对jdbc的操作数据库的过程进行封装,使开发者只需要关注 SQL 本身,而不需要花费精力去处理例如注册驱
mybatis in查询怎么写 mybatis 插入返回id mybatis 映射成多个list sql xml